Welcome!! the guru of building frame structures!.I decided to enroll in your ranks and to build myself a half or a (semi-) construction, which will be called as a service building.
The size of the planned house is about 7950 *3670 (chosen from the needs and the opportunities with regard to the size of the sheet materials and its minimization of cutting).
The sesrvie building will have on the ground floor:
* a room
* an entrance hall, and a kitchen
* a combined bathroom (shower, WC)
And in the attic space there will be kind of 2-bedrooms
.
The layout of the 1st floor in the miniatures.
All internal walls are slight and aren’t supporting. Only the perimeter will carry - the outer walls, and, basically, as I understand it, the two long walls, because there will no load-bearing columns inside.
The construction will be built on the hillside, across the slope (the facade to the street, the slope to the pond, the pond is about 80 meters).
The map of the height drop in the corners of the building lokks as follows (from the pond to the street):
-60 -20
-400
The soil – a chernozem about 1 meter and then it smoothly passes into something of a clay and a sand. There is no water of 2-d metres depth. I make hole on November last year. But everything is dry and comfort.
Based on the received information from the Internet and books, there were decided to make the foundation columnar with a grillage of 150x150. It was necessary to fast the timber on the posts by putting the vertical axis on the pin of each column without screwing by the nut (in the case of discrepancy of columns in the vertical axis, so that you can equalize the height by the pads, just in case, for short). The tape has disappeared because of the significant inclines.
The layout of the foundation and their parameters in miniature.
Then I ‘am planning to tie the perimeter by the board of 150*50, floor beams. The flooring is - OSB-3, a thickness of 18mm. The bottom hem is OSB-3, 10 mm. Inside, as expected, the layers and a glass wool “Isover”, a layer of 200 mm.
The scheme of arrangement of the floor in in miniature. (only the frame and the upper deck).
Then I continue to design...
That's a lot of thought about all this:
1. The mass of the building (excluding the mass of the foundation pillars), about 7-8 tons, I take a technological reserve of 25% - 2 tons + a snow load from the roof with a slope of 50 degrees to the horizon - 3.2 tons (61 sq. m. * 180 * (60 -50) / 35). Total, "the peak" mass of this “joy” will be almost 13-14 tons.
2. The support area of my posts: 45 * 45 * 12 pieces = 24 300 square centimeters. The undercutting ground support of the pillar I accept as 1.2 meters (you never know, will it suddenly become swollen or crawl slowly the upper layer). Thus, if we assume the carrying capacity of the soil to a minimum - 1 kg / sq cm. having a carrying capacity of the foundation of 24.3 tons.
And now the questions:
1. Whether the foundation is correctly selected and counted?
2. Is it enough the beam of 150 x 150?. I honestly doubt, since the entire burden of the house is 13-14 tonnes, will fall through the walls on it, and it's about a one ton per meter or 0.6 kg per square cm. To be honest when I counted everything, I began to think about a reinforced concrete grillage of posts...
3. Whether the floor beams are laid correctly? The ground joist based on a timber grillage of 10 cm on each side. A cross-section of joists is 200 * 50. The length of the ground joist is 3.57 m. The length of the ground joist is 3.37 m. The step of the ground joist is about 50 cm.
So, there are now these questions, I ask knowledgeable and experienced experts and practitioners to dispel my doubts, or to put on the right path. I would be inordinately grateful!
